The set resulted in uncertainty and unease in both the cast and the audience by articulating a relationship to M. C. Esther and establishing a dark and heavy palette. Other successes in the production included the flexibility and the acting space that was afforded to blocking. The play integrated good principles of production and was framed artistically regarding actors, colours, shapes, and props. Furthermore, the supernatural elements were introduced at the start of the production by bringing in three wicked witches. The play gains a supernatural atmosphere when the witches enter the scene. The witches talk about the “battle being lost and one” in the opening scene and about meeting Macbeth and the spirits. The use of the weather illustrates the mood of the scene.
